Position Summary

The Maintenance Planner ensures reliable operation of plant equipment by planning, scheduling, and coordinating maintenance activities while also fulfilling expanded parts and inventory responsibilities. As a Pennant team member, the candidate ensure safety and food safety is a condition and drive manufacturing operational improvements. Furthermore, the candidate must embrace and support the building operations.

 

Required Competencies

  • Manage maintenance parts inventory including ordering, receiving, labeling, storage, and documentation.
  • Receive and enter all parts into MaintainX, including quantities and storage locations.
  • Perform quarterly cycle counts and reconcile variances.
  • Maintain and update BOMs and preventive maintenance plans in MaintainX.
  • Conduct routine MaintainX audits to verify PM completion accuracy and documentation.
  • Attend shift changeover meetings for daily alignment.
  • Participate in weekly maintenance huddles.
  • Join quarterly KPI and past-due work order reviews.
  • Coordinate with production and supply chain.
  • Create and add new assets in MaintainX for new or upgraded equipment.
  • Develop SOPs (standard operating procedures) for new, upgraded, or modified equipment.
  • Contact vendors and assist with planned contractor work orders, scheduling, communication, and processing requisitions.

 

Required Education / Experience

  • High School diploma or GED
  • Strong understanding of preventive and predictive maintenance principles.
  • Ability to read and interpret technical manuals, diagrams, and OEM documentation.
  • Familiarity with CMMS systems (SAP PM, MaintainX preferred).
  • Understanding of inventory control practices and spare parts management.
  • Strong communication skills for coordinating with vendors, contractors, and internal teams.
  • Working knowledge of safety programs and OSHA maintenance-related requirements.

 

PHYSICAL DEMANDS/WORK ENVIRONMENT

  • Overtime hours may be required based on work demand. Employee must be flexible with these hours.
  • The employee must occasionally lift and/or move objects over 50 pounds.
  • While performing the duties of this job, the employee at times can be exposed to flour/sugar dust particles.  The dust levels in the work environment can sometimes be elevated.  If needed, proper PPE is provided.
  • Noise levels in some plant locations are loud.
  • The employee may spend 75% or more of their work hours on the plant floor.
  • While performing the duties of this job, the employee is frequently required to bend, stoop, walk and lift throughout the shift.
  • GMPs require hair nets, beard nets to be worn on production areas.
  • Uniforms and safety shoes will be provided along with any other specific required PPE.

 

Compensation

  • Hourly compensation for this position is based on skills and experience, ranging from $30.00 - $42.00

This is Puratos

At Puratos, we create innovative food solutions for the health and well-being of people everywhere. As the global leader in bakery, patisserie and chocolate ingredients, we help our customers to be successful with their business, by turning technologies and experiences from food cultures around the world into new opportunities.
We are more than 10.000 employees in over 80 countries and a consolidated turnover of 3 billion euros (in 2023). Our passion for innovation, a pioneering spirit and the unique Puratos culture drive our solid growth and vision for the future This, along with our commitment to our local communities, is what makes working at Puratos so magical.
